Claim of adding Awasthi surname to Muslim leader’s name
Aatish Aziz said in a post on social media on Tuesday that he is a registered voter of Kolkata Port Assembly constituency and his name is Aatish Aziz. He said that the voter list inspection While doing so, he found that the surname ‘Awasthi’ was added to his name and the same wrong surname was written in front of his father’s name also.
He said, “My father has been a politician for decades. If such a mistake could have happened in his case, then imagine what would have happened to others.” He questioned that if there were such fundamental mistakes then what was achieved by the special intensive review (SIR) conducted at a cost of crores of rupees.
‘Made me and my father Brahmins’
He said, “On one hand, BJP was celebrating the fact that the SIR process would be used to crack down on Muslims, while on the other hand, the Election Commission made both my father Mohammad Salim and me Brahmins by adding the surname Awasthi.”
Aatish Aziz also shared pictures of the draft voter list, which has ‘Awasthi’ added at the end of his and his father’s names. He said that the booth-level agent of CPIM in the area has been informed and the issue is being discussed with the office of the Chief Electoral Officer. Election Commission of West Bengal on Tuesday (16 December 2025) after SIR draft Voters A list was released in which about Names of about 58 lakh people were deleted.
